So.. I looked more at the European treaties. According to the council of Europe, Slovakia did sign ETS No.024 as follows
" Details of Treaty No.024
European Convention on Extradition
The European Convention on Extradition provides for the extradition between Parties of persons wanted for criminal proceedings or for the carrying out of a sentence. The Convention does not apply to political or military offences and any Party may refuse to extradite its own citizens to a foreign country.

With regard to fiscal offences (taxes, duties, customs) extradition may only be granted if the Parties have decided so in respect of any such offence or category of offences. Extradition may also be refused if the person claimed risks the death penalty under the law of the requesting State"

''Oliver Karafa and Yun (Lucy) Lu Li flew to eastern Europe within 24 hours of a shooting that left 39-year-old Tyler Pratt dead, Hamilton police say. A woman was also critically injured, but survived.

The two travelled through several countries, including Slovakia and the Czech Republic, before arriving in Budapest, says Det.-Sgt. Jim Callender.

They were arrested on June 12 and investigators in Hamilton were notified a short time later.

"It's been a journey that has taken a lot of strides and a lot of new information that has led to this," Callender said during a media update on Monday.''


''Callender would not say what police believe led to the shooting, saying it forms evidence for the case, but added he's "very comfortable with the motivation for the shooting and the murder."

A 26-year-old woman was seriously injured in the incident, and has since left hospital and is continuing to recover.''

''In a media release issued Monday morning, Hamilton police said those efforts, along with the work of the Hungarian Fugitive Active Search Team, led to the pair's arrest in Budapest, where they're in custody.


"The efforts of the police services are what led to this," said Callender. His office worked with RCMP liaison officers for the European Union to track down the suspects, he said.''

Criminal Code
''When child becomes human being

  • 223 (1) A child becomes a human being within the meaning of this Act when it has completely proceeded, in a living state, from the body of its mother, whether or not
    • (a) it has breathed;

    • (b) it has an independent circulation; or

    • (c) the navel string is severed.
  • Marginal note:Killing child

    (2) A person commits homicide when he causes injury to a child before or during its birth as a result of which the child dies after becoming a human being.
  • R.S., c. C-34, s. 206''
 
Criminal Code
Killing unborn child in act of birth

  • 238 (1) Every one who causes the death, in the act of birth, of any child that has not become a human being, in such a manner that, if the child were a human being, he would be guilty of murder, is guilty of an indictable offence and liable to imprisonment for life.

  • Marginal note:Saving

    (2) This section does not apply to a person who, by means that, in good faith, he considers necessary to preserve the life of the mother of a child, causes the death of that child.
  • R.S., c. C-34, s. 221

Lucy Li waives extradition, returning to Canada after Budapest arrest

Hamilton police confirmed that the 26-year-old victim was pregnant at the time and the shooting resulted in the loss of the pregnancy. It does not change the charges the pair face.
...
They were arrested with fake identification.
...
Canadian authorities have 30 days, until July 14, to send extradition information to Budapest.

It is unclear how fast Li will be put on a plane, but she will be escorted by police.
...
It’s possible for the decision on whether Karafa will be extradited to take many months, during which time bail is not possible.

According to extradition agreements between the countries Karafa can only be extradited if the crime he faces is also a crime in Hungary — this is called the principal of dual criminality. Accused persons are also only extradited if they face a significant (at least two years) and there cannot be any risk of execution or human rights violations.
